I´m trying to figure out the root of my acne problem. Doctors don´t help at all. I´m studying medicine, too, and it doesn´t help neither. I feel so lost :(

Sometimes I think my acne must be hormonal (I´m a 28 year old girl, acne started at 23) because it´s on my chin and around the mouth.

The problem is that my blood tests are perfect and do not show any imbalance. I have read a lot of threads here and know that this can be totally possible and still have hormonal acne.

But my doubt is: every other thing related to hormonal imbalances is ok in me: don´t have irregular periods, don´t have pms, my periods don´t hurt at all, don´t have hirsutism, and I don´t neccesarily see a conection between my pimples and the time of the cycle I am in. Is it still possible for me to have hormonal acne? I would be very thankful if you girls could tell me if you have irregular periods etc, or not.

Yes it's very possible that your acne is hormonal even though you don't have any red flags. I tried just about everything you can try to treat acne. Every antibiotic, 5 different topicals, proactive, BP, SA, and Accutane. After I did my Accutane course I did get clear skin, of course 3 months later I started to break out again. I had heard a lot about Spirolactone after jointing this website for support during my Accutane course. I decided to give it a shot even though I was sure my acne was not hormonal. To my surprise it cleared my skin right up. I've been taking it for 15 months now and I love it! Just one pill a day, no side effects, something I can rely on. No more waking up and being scared to look in the mirror to see what my face would look like today. So a search on this site for spiro and you will see a lot of information about it and see stories.

 

The location of your acne screams hormonal acne. Your dermatologist can prescribe it, or your OBGYN can prescribe it. Something to consider for sure!

It is safe for you to take spiro and dianette at the same time. I would ask your derm or OBGYN about it for sure. My dermatologist never mentioned spiro to me either. I was on Accutane when I joined this site for support and looking around at other peoples logs I would see that after women finished their courses and acne started to return that spiro would often clear the skin again. So I always kept it in the back of my mind to give that a shot if my acne returned. Low and behold 3 months after my Accutane course, I started to break out again. At this point I decided to meet with my OBGYN since they are way more experienced with hormonal acne than most dermatologists. My OBGYN was all for prescribing the spiro which was a relief. That same day she tested my hormonal levels and prescribed me the medication. About a week later I got the results and they were all within normal range. So I didn't think spiro would work but she told me to continue with the medication anyways and see what happens to my acne. Sure enough it cleared my skin up and has kept me clear besides from the occasional zit I get.
